Understanding Titanium Headers
Titanium headers are structural components made from titanium, renowned for their strength, corrosion resistance, and lightweight properties. They are commonly used in bridges, buildings, and other infrastructure projects. Proper installation is crucial to maximize their benefits and ensure safety.

Incorrect Measurements and Sizing
One of the most common mistakes is miscalculating the dimensions needed for the headers. Always double-check measurements and consult engineering specifications before cutting or ordering titanium headers. Using precise tools and calibration can prevent sizing errors that compromise structural integrity.
Poor Surface Preparation
Surface cleanliness is vital for proper welding and fastening. Remove any rust, dirt, or debris from the installation area. Proper surface preparation ensures strong bonds and reduces the risk of corrosion or failure over time.
Inadequate Fastening Methods
Using the wrong type or size of fasteners can lead to loosening or failure. Always follow manufacturer guidelines and industry standards for fastening titanium headers. Consider using specialized titanium bolts and washers designed for high-stress applications.
Ignoring Thermal Expansion
Titanium expands and contracts with temperature changes. Allow for thermal expansion during installation by leaving appropriate gaps and using flexible fastening solutions. This prevents stress buildup that could cause cracks or deformation.
Skipping Quality Inspections
Regular inspections during and after installation help identify issues early. Check for proper alignment, secure fastening, and surface integrity. Quality control ensures the longevity and safety of your titanium headers.
